5 Reasons Your Children Are Not Getting Enough Play
Words: 525 | Date: Sun, 17 Oct 2010


I think it's no secret to most parents that kids don't get the time to play like we did when we were kids. Do you remember? At least in my town, we pretty much had free reign to do whatever we wanted all day if we weren't in school, and we spent that time running through the woods, playing games, or getting into all kinds of imaginary mischief in the yard. Riding bikes around town or walking to the river were also common activities.

Now, it seems kids have less energy and less passion for play, and a multitude of modern variables are deteriorating the span of time in which kids just get to be kids. Here are some reasons it's happening.

1. A Changing World

First off, the world has just changed, and that's not always a good thing in every way. Kids have unlimited access to video games, movies, cell phones, the internet, and all kinds of electronic media now. Their idea of what constitutes a good time is a bit different than what ours was, and they spend a lot of time just wired in.

2. Busy Schedules

Another thing that has changed is the modern American's lifestyle. We are all prisoners to our schedules now. We're always working or running errands, and we find ourselves having to set aside specific times to make sure our kids get to play—a term that is becoming known as the "play date." These times don't always go as planned. The rest of our busy life often gets in the way, and the result is less and less of these structured times to let loose.

3. Strict Parents

Some parents just expect a little too much out of children. It's often because they want them to be the ultimate success in life—to do better in school, sports, and life than all the others. It's understandable to want the best for your child, but some parent's need to lighten up a little bit and relinquish control.

4. Paranoid Parents

The media bombards us these days with stories of violent crimes people who prey on children. These things happen no more than in the past—in fact, many researches claim that the odds of your child being kidnapped or otherwise victimized have actually gone way down. Sensationalism just puts it in the spotlight, drawing our attention to it, and as a result we are afraid to let our kids out of the house alone.

5. Misunderstanding Play

Finally, many parents just don't realize how important it is to play. Casual play is the most important natural method of cognitive and physical development, and children need this time to build skills for life.

Some parents don't realize this and add it all up to just goofing off. Some may even think that encouraging too much horsing around somehow limits your child's maturity development, but when you understand just how vital this type of activity is, it becomes much easier to let it run its course.
